| The
Sivananda Yoga Vedanta Center has been in LA for over 35 years. It
was founded by Swami Vishnu-devananda. We teach authentic Classical
Yoga. The teachings are based on the five points for perfect health:
* Proper Exercise (Asanas)
* Proper Breathing (Pranayama)
* Proper Relaxation (Savasan)
* Proper Diet (Vegetarian)
* Positive Thinking and Meditation (Vedanta Philosophy)
In
addition to the five points, the teachings of the Center are based
upon the four paths of Yoga:
* Karma Yoga - The Yoga of Action
* Bhakti Yoga - The Path of Devotion or Divine Love
* Jnana Yoga - The Yoga of Knowledge or Wisdom
* Raja Yoga - The Science of Physical and Mental Control

The
spiritual strength behind the Center are the teachings of Swami
Sivananda. These teachings are a synthesis of all the formal
doctrines of Yoga. He authored more than 300 books on Yoga and Vedanta
Philosophy. He trained many exceptinoal disciples in Yoga and Vedanta
- among them Swami Vishnu-devananda.
In
1957 Swami Sivananda sent Swami Vishnu-devananda to spread the practice
of Yoga in the West. Swami Sivananda summarized his teachings in
the following words:
"Serve, Love, Give, Purify, Meditate, Realize"

The
Centers were founded in 1959 by Swami
Vishnu-devananda as a non-profit organization whose purpose
is to propagate the teachings of Yoga and Vedanta as a means of
achieving physical, mental and spiritual well-being and Self-Realization.
Swami
Vishnu-devananda was a World renowned authority on Hatha Yoga and
Raja Yoga. He was the author of the bestseller "The Complete Illustrated
Book of Yoga", "Meditation and Mantras" and other books. |
